“…Extracellular vesicles (EVs) including exosomes and microvesicles are emerging innovative nano-sized drug delivery system (DDS) for cancer therapy [31]. EVs can be an ideal delivery vehicle for cancer therapeutic agents thanks to their many unique merits such as biological barrier penetration ability, tumor homing and organotropism, good bioavailability [10], innate stability and multi-drug loading capacity, little toxicity and immunogenicity [32]. Increasing evidences have demonstrated the great potential of EVs for delivery of therapeutic proteins and siRNAs for cancer treatment.…”

“…The safety of EV administration has been demonstrated by several phase I clinical studies with no grade II toxicity or maximal tolerated dose being found [8]. As an ideal drug delivery system, EVs can deliver not only soluble cargoes like microRNAs and mRNAs [9] but also membrane bound therapeutic molecules such as proteins and lipids [10].…”

“…Exosomes secreted from MSCs are promising biological tools for targeted therapy in cancer. In this context, the injection of exosomes armed with TRAIL (Exo-TRAIL) secreted from MSCs reduced the tumor volume in tumor-bearing mice [ 206 ]. In a separate study using TRAIL resistant MCF-7 ER+ breast cancer cells, cell death was significantly increased when treated with ASCs overexpressing SMAC and TRAIL [ 207 ].…”
